White Oak's game last Tuesday was a loss, but they didn't let that memory haunt them on Thursday. They walked away with a 38-26 win over the Queen City Bulldogs. The victory was some much needed relief for the Roughnecks as it spelled an end to their four-game losing streak.
White Oak's win bumped their record up to 4-7. As for Queen City,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 7-3.
